Self Aligning Ball Bearings 1313K

The 1313K is a self-aligning ball bearing with a 65mm tapered bore and 140mm outer diameter, crafted from sturdy chrome steel. It manages radial loads up to 14625 lbf and operates smoothly at speeds up to 6000 RPM.

Its double-row design and open seal type allow for easy lubrication and maintenance, while the nylon cage reduces friction for quieter performance. The bearing works reliably in temperatures ranging from -30°C to 110°C.

This model is interchangeable with SKF bearings, making it a practical choice for replacements. Suitable for applications like conveyor systems or agricultural machinery where misalignment might occur.

Weighing 2.35kg, it’s robust yet manageable for its size. Compliant with RoHS and REACH standards, ensuring safe and eco-friendly use.

Product Parameters

  • Part Number 1313K
  • Brand TFL & OEM
  • Interchangeable SKF
  • Bore Dia 65 mm
  • Bore Dia Tolerance -0.015mm to 0
  • Outer Dia 140 mm
  • Outer Dia Tolerance -0.018mm to 0
  • Width 33 mm
  • Width Tolerance -0.15mm to 0
  • External Diameter On Inner Ring 99 mm
  • Internal Diameter On Outer Ring 125.2 mm
  • Chamfer Dimension 2 mm
  • System of Measurement Metric
  • Bearing Type Ball
  • Bore Type Taper 1:12
  • For Load Direction Radial
  • Construction Double Row
  • Seal Type Open
  • Ring Material Chrome Steel
  • Ball Material Chrome Steel
  • Cage Material Nylon
  • Dynamic Radial Load 14625 lbf
  • Static Radial Load 5738 lbf
  • Lubrication Lubricated
  • Temperature Range -30° to 110 °C
  • Radial Clearance CN
  • RoHS Compliant
  • REACH Compliant
  • Max Speed 6000 rpm
  • Weight 2.35 kg
